INTRODUCTION
|
|
------------
|
|
IBM's VMSSP mainframe operating system is for one of the most
|
|
sophistocated computers available today, the IBM 303x and 308x families of
|
|
processors. These computers can handle vast quantities of memory, handle
|
|
hundereds of users logged in at one time, plus access many high-volume hard
|
|
disks at once. To someone who has only used an Apple, a VMSSP computer would
|
|
definitely fit the title 'supercomputer'. This series of
|
|
tutorial text files will attempt to give the reader enough knowledge about the
|
|
system to perform some usefulddestructivewwhatever tasks on
|
|
hishher own.

LOGGING IN
|
|
----------
|
|
Logging onto the computer is, of course the first and most important
|
|
step. The first thing you have to find is a valid username. This can be hard
|
|
to do, because there is, to my knowledge, no way of seeing who is on a
|
|
system before you have logged in. Very clever for security, but not too
|
|
friendly for the average userhhacker. If you need to hack out a username, they
|
|
are from 1 to 8 characters long, and have a 1-to-8 character password
|
|
associated with them. Start out by trying such common first and last names
|
|
like 'Jones', etc.
|
|
The login command on a VMSSP system is, quite simply, LOGIN (or LOGON). You
|
|
would issue the login command like this:
|
|
.LOGIN <username> [<password>]
|
|
(The '.' is the prompt, and <password> is optional; if you don't supply a
|
|
password, the system will prompt you for one.) If the username you have tried
|
|
isn't valid, you will get the message:
|
|
DMKLOG053E <userid> NOT IN CP DIRECTORY
|
|
If the password you've tried is wrong, this message will appear:
|
|
DMKLOG050E PASSWORD INCORRECT
|
|
If there is already somebody logged in
|
|
on the account you've tried, you will get this message:
|
|
DMKLOG054E ALREADY LOGGED ON {LINE|GRAF|LUNAME} raddr
|
|
Once you've gotten a correct usernameppassword combination, you will
|
|
be greeted with this line:
|
|
LOGMSG- hh:mm:ss mmdddyyy
|
|
This indicates when the system logon message was most recently revised. Then
|
|
the system logon message will be displayed, and you will be told if you
|
|
have any files waiting for you in your 'reader' (which will be explained
|
|
later). This message will look like this:
|
|
FILES: {nnn|NO} RDR, {nnn|NO} PRT, {nnn|NO} PUN
|
|
One important thing to look for is one of the following messages:
|
|
LOGON AT hh:mm:ss zone weekday mmdddyyy
|
|
RECONNECTED AT hh:mm:ss zone weekday mmdddyyy
|
|
RECONNECTED means that you have ben re-connected to a session that was stopped
|
|
using the 'DISC' command instead of just logging out. You should get off this
|
|
as soon as possible, as the person who disconnected probably will be wanting to
|
|
get back onto their account.

QUERY
|
|
-----
|
|
The QUERY command is used to get various bits of information about your
|
|
session on the machine, and various other system statistics. There are many
|
|
options associated with this command, and only a few of them will be described
|
|
here. (Note: the QUERY command can be abbreviated to just 'Q')
|
|
|
|
Q TIME - display the current time and date on the screen
|
|
Q Reader|PRinter|PUnch - displays on the screen files, if any, in the
|
|
reader.
|
|
Q DIsK [mode] - Gives information about the various 'minidisks' attached
|
|
to the session at one time.
|
|
Q SEARCH - Similar to Q DISK.
|
|
Q USERS - Tell how many users are logged on to the system.
|
|
Q NAMES - give the usernames and terminal addresses of all users logged
|
|
onto the system.
|
|
|
|
LISTFILE [<fn> <ft> [<fm>]]
|
|
---------------------------
|
|
The LISTFILE will give a list of all or some of the files on one of the
|
|
minidisks attached. The wildcard character '*' can be used to search for
|
|
groups of files with a certain filenameffiletype.
|
|
|
|
GIME <label> [<cuu>] [<fm>]
|
|
---------------------------
|
|
The GIME command will attach another user's (or the system's) disk to
|
|
your session. <cuu> stands for the 'address' associated with that disk, and
|
|
<fm> is which 'mode' you want it stuck at. Modes are from A to Z. <label> is
|
|
the 'name' associated with the particular disk.
|
|
|
|
DROP <fm>
|
|
---------
|
|
The DROP command is the opposite of GIME; that is, it will detach a disk
|
|
from your session. <fm> is the mode where the disk was GIME'd.
|
|
|
|
BASIC
|
|
-----
|
|
This will invoke the IBM BASIC interpreter, which is, if you ask me,
|
|
severely brain-damaged. I would avoid it.
|
|
|
|
FORTVS <fn>
|
|
-----------
|
|
This invokes the IBM VS FORTRAN-77 compiler. The file <fn> should have a
|
|
filetype of FORTRAN. The compiler will generate a file called <fn> TEXT, which
|
|
contains the equivalent of an .OBJ file (for you CPMM and MS-DOS users) or a
|
|
.REL file.
|
|
|
|
LOAD <fn> (START
|
|
----------------
|
|
This will load the file <fn> TEXT into memory and begin execution.
|
|
|
|
TELL <user> <message>
|
|
---------------------
|
|
This command will send <message> to <user>. Pretty basic. If the user
|
|
isn't logged on, the operating system will tell you.
|
|
|
|
LOGOFF
|
|
------
|
|
Self-explanatory.
|
|
|
|
DISCONNECT
|
|
----------
|
|
This command will disconnect your terminal from your session, but still
|
|
leave the session logged onto the system, in 'DSC' mode. You can re-log
|
|
on to your session using the 'LOGON' command, and return to the same place
|
|
you were at when you disconnected. Handy if you have to go off somewhere
|
|
but don't want to destroy the environment you have set up.
|
|
|
|
RECEIVE [<id#>]
|
|
---------------
|
|
The RECEIVE command is used to read files in your 'reader' onto your
|
|
minidisk. Each file in the reader has an id# associated with it, and this is
|
|
how you read in the file. If no id# is supplied by the user, the system will
|
|
just RECEIVE the first file in the reader.

PRIVILEGE CLASSES
|
|
=================
|
|
A VM SYSTEM USES WHAT ARE CALLED PRIVILEGE CLASSES TO DETERMINE WHICH
|
|
COMMANDS A USER CAN USE. THEY RANGE FROM A TO G. THE MEANINGS OF THE
|
|
DIFFERENT CLASSES ARE AS FOLLOWS:
|
|
|
|
A PRIMARY SYSTEM OPERATOR.
|
|
B SYSTEM RESOURCE OPERATOR.
|
|
C SYSTEM PROGRAMMER.
|
|
D SPOOLING OPERATOR.
|
|
E SYSTEM ANALYST.
|
|
F SERVICE REPRESENTATIVE.
|
|
G GENERAL USER.
|
|
|
|
MOST USERS ARE CLASS G, WITH VARYING NUMBERS OF USERS BEING B,C,D,E,F. THERE
|
|
IS ONE IMPORTANT CLASS A USER, KNOWN AS 'MASTEROP'. THIS IS A SPECIAL USERNAME
|
|
THAT IS LOGGED ONTO THE SYSTEM CONSOLE, AND CAN DO BASICALLY ANYTHING ON THE
|
|
SYSTEM. CLASS C USERS CAN MODIFY REAL STORAGE (AS OPPOSED TO VIRTUAL STORAGE),
|
|
WHICH CAN HAVE PARTICULARLY NASTY CONSEQUENCES, IF THE 'RIGHT' AREAS OF
|
|
STORAGE ARE ALTERED IN A CERTAIN FASHION. YOU MUST BE VERY CAREFUL WHEN
|
|
FIDDLING WITH REAL STORAGE.
|
|
|
|
DETACH {REALADDR} [FROM] {SOMETHING}
|
|
THE DETACH COMMAND (CLASS B) CAN BE USED TO DETACH REAL DEVICES FROM THE
|
|
SYSTEM, SUCH AS PRINTERS, DISK DRIVES, TERMINALS, ETC. {REALADDR} IS THE REAL
|
|
ADDRESS OF THE DEVICE, AND {SOMETHING} CAN BE EITHER A USERID OR SYSTEM. THIS
|
|
COMMAND CAN BE VERY NASTY, AND CAN CAUSE LOTS OF PROBLEMS.
|
|
|
|
DISABLE {RADDR|SNA|ALL}
|
|
THE DISABLE COMMAND (CLASS A OR B) CAN BE USED TO PREVENT CERTAIN TERMINALS
|
|
(OR ALL TERMINALS) FROM LOGGING ONTO THE SYSTEM. PARTICULARLY NASTY. THE
|
|
OPPOSITE OF THIS COMMAND IS, OBVIOUSLY, ENABLE.
|
|
|
|
FORCE USERID
|
|
THE FORCE (CLASS A) COMMAND WILL FORCIBLY LOG OFF ANY USER SPECIFIED.
|
|
THIS COMMAND IS MOSTLY USED TO FREE TERMINALS WHERE SOMEONE'S SESSION MIGHT
|
|
HAVE BECOME SCREWED UP, BUT IT CAN ALSO BE USED TO JUST CREATE GENERAL HAVOC
|
|
(I.E. TERMINATING SYSTEM JOBS, ETC).
|
|
|
|
MESSAGE {ALL|USERID|*|OPERATOR} MSG
|
|
THE MESSAGE COMMAND (CLASS A OR B) IS USED TO SEND A TEXT MESSAGE TO A
|
|
SPECIFIED USER, THE PRIMARY SYSTEM OPERATOR (WHOEVER IT MIGHT BE), OR TO
|
|
ALL USERS LOGGED ONTO THE SYSTEM.
|
|
|
|
MSGNOH {USERID|ALL|*} MSG
|
|
THE MSGNOH COMMAND (CLASS B) WILL SEND MESSAGES TO SPECIFIED USERS OR ALL
|
|
USERS WITHOUT THE STANDARD HEADER ASSOCIATED WITH REGULAR TERMINAL
|
|
MESSAGES. THIS IS NORMALLY USED BY SOME SYSTEM JOB THAT MIGHT SEND YOU A
|
|
MESSAGE, BUT CAN ALSO BE USED TO ANONYMOUSLY HASSLE PEOPLE. I'D AVOID
|
|
USING IT ON THE SYSTEM OPERATOR.
|
|
|
|
WARNING {USERID|OPERATOR|ALL} MSG
|
|
THE WARNING COMMAND (CLASS A OR B) SENDS A HIGH-PRIORITY MESSAGE TO A
|
|
DESIGNATED USER, OR TO ALL THE USERS ON THE SYSTEM. THIS MESSAGE WILL INTERRUPT
|
|
ANYTHING THAT IS CURRENTLY BEING DONE, UNLIKE THE MESSAGE COMMAND WHICH WILL
|
|
WAIT FOR TERMINAL INPUT BEFORE IT IS DISPLAYED.

THE HELP FACILITY
|
|
-----------------
|
|
VMSSP SYSTEMS HAVE A VERY EXTENSIVE HELP FACILITY, WHICH WILL GIVE
|
|
INFORMATION ON JUST ABOUT EVERY COMMAND IN THE SYSTEM, ALONG WITH MANY OF THE
|
|
PROGRAMS, COMPILERS, ETC. THAT MAY BE RESIDENT ON THE SYSTEM. THIS CAN BE
|
|
VERY HELPFUL IF YOU'RE EVER MYSTIFIED BY THE FORMAT OF A CERTAIN COMMAND. TO
|
|
GET HELP ON A CERTAIN COMMAND, JUST TRY HELP COMMAND. IF THIS DOESN'T PROVIDE
|
|
ANYTHING, THEN THERE IS ALSO THE AID FACILITY, WHICH CAN POINT YOU TOWARDS
|
|
HELP ON BROADER SUBJECTS. THE COMBINATION OF HELP AND AID HELP TO MAKE
|
|
VMSSP ONE OF THE MOST USER-FRIENDLY OPERATING SYSTEMS AROUND. HELP EVEN
|
|
GIVES INFORMATION ON SOME PRIVILEGED COMMANDS.
|
|
|
|
RSCS AND NETWORKING
|
|
-------------------
|
|
VMSSP SYSTEMS USE A METHOD OF NETWORKING COMPUTERS TOGETHER KNOWN AS
|
|
RSCS. USING RSCS (WHICH IS THE NAME OF A SYSTEM JOB THAT RUNS IN DISCONNECT
|
|
MODE), THE SYSTEM CAN TRANSMIT FILES, USER MESSAGES, MAIL, PRINT JOBS, ETC.,
|
|
TO REMOTE COMPUTERS. THE RSCS MACHINE CAN BE GIVEN COMMANDS TO PERFORM SOME
|
|
TASKS FOR A USER, SUCH AS LOOKING ON OTHER COMPUTERS TO SEE WHO'S LOGGED ON,
|
|
ETC. COMMANDS ARE TRANSMITTED WITH THE SMSG RSCS COMMAND. FOR INSTANCE, IF YOU
|
|
WANTED TO SEE WHO WAS LOGGED ONTO A REMOTE COMPUTER CALLED 'FRITZ', YOU
|
|
WOULD ISSUE THE FOLLOWING COMMAND:
|
|
SMSG RSCS CMD FRITZ QUERY NAMES
|
|
FOR MORE INFORMATION ON RSCS COMMANDS, YOU CAN ALWAYS CHECK OUT THE HELP AND
|
|
AID FACILITIES.
|
|
|
|
SYSTEM DISKS
|
|
------------
|
|
THE SYSTEM USUALLY HAS DISKS THAT ARE AUTOMATICALLY ATTACHED TO YOUR
|
|
SESSION WHEN YOU LOG IN, AND ARE MOST LIKELY TO BE LOCATED AT MODES S,T,U,W,Y.
|
|
THESE DISKS CONTAIN THE VARIOUS 'EXTERNAL' COMMANDS (LIKE 'EXTERNAL'
|
|
COMMANDS IN MS-DOS), IMPORTANT PROGRAMS (SUCH AS THE EDITOR, XEDIT), COMPILERS,
|
|
ETC. YOU MUST BE CAREFUL NOT TO DROP THESE DISKS, ESPECIALLY THE S DISK (OR
|
|
THE ONE LOCATED AT CUU 190 IF IT ISN'T AT S), AS IF YOU DO, YOU MIGHT RUN INTO
|
|
TROUBLE.
